I expect the same would be possible here. > > > > (On the other hand, it would be interesting to learn how one can > > dowload mbox from a public inbox, because in vger.kernel.org we only > > have a public inbox.) > > At least on inbox.sourceware.org you can download the result of any > search as mbox. And search is fairly powerful. See e.g. > https://inbox.sourceware.org/libc-alpha/_/text/help/ > > So for example to get all message from the last week you'll do: > https://inbox.sourceware.org/libc-alpha/?q=d%3Alast.week.. And then > at the top you can download the result as mbox (with or without full > message threads).
